CPU comparisonIntel Xeon Platinum 8360H or AMD EPYC 75F3 -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.
The Intel Xeon Platinum 8360H has 24 cores with 48 threads and clocks with a maximum frequency of 4.20 GHz. Up to 1146 GB of memory is supported in 6 memory channels. The Intel Xeon Platinum 8360H was released in Q2/2020. The AMD EPYC 75F3 has 32 cores with 64 threads and clocks with a maximum frequency of 4.00 GHz. The CPU supports up to 4096 GB of memory in 8 memory channels. The AMD EPYC 75F3 was released in Q1/2021. |

CPU Cores and Base FrequencyThe Intel Xeon Platinum 8360H is a 24 core processor with a clock frequency of 3.00 GHz (4.20 GHz). The AMD EPYC 75F3 has 32 CPU cores with a clock frequency of 2.95 GHz (4.00 GHz). |

Memory & PCIeThe Intel Xeon Platinum 8360H supports a maximum of 1146 GB of memory in 6 memory channels. The AMD EPYC 75F3 can connect up to 4096 GB of memory in 8 memory channels. |

Thermal ManagementThe TDP (Thermal Design Power) of a processor specifies the required cooling solution. The Intel Xeon Platinum 8360H has a TDP of 225 W, that of the AMD EPYC 75F3 is 280 W. |
